A Model Context Protocol (MCP) server for Claude/Cursor that enables searching and exploring OpenAPI specifications through oapis.org.

    What are the main functions of the Slack API?

    The Slack API offers a wide range of functionalities through its Web API, enabling developers to interact with the Slack platform programmatically. Here are the main functions and features available through the Slack API:

    1. Admin Functions:

      • Manage apps: Approve, restrict, and list approved apps.
      • Manage conversations: Create, delete, and archive channels; convert public channels to private.
      • User management: Invite users, remove users, and assign roles (admin, owner).
    2. Chat and Messaging:

      • Send messages: Post messages, schedule messages, delete messages, and manage ephemeral messages.
      • Reactions: Add, remove, and list reactions on messages.
      • Threads: Manage replies and threaded conversations.
    3. File Management:

      • Upload, delete, and list files.
      • Add comments to files and manage public URLs.
    4. User Management:

      • Retrieve user information, profiles, and presence status.
      • Manage user groups and their memberships.
    5. Conversations:

      • List, invite members to, and manage channel settings.
      • Retrieve conversation history and member lists.
    6. Event Handling:

      • Manage events and subscriptions for app events.
      • Handle workflow steps and completions.
    7. Authentication:

      • Manage OAuth tokens and permissions.
      • Test API calls and revoke tokens.
    8. Search and Pins:

      • Search messages across channels.
      • Pin and unpin messages or files.
    9. Reminders:

      • Create, list, and delete reminders.
    10. Views and Dialogs:

      • Open and update modals and views for user interactions.
    11. Real-Time Messaging:

      • Connect to the real-time messaging (RTM) API for instant updates.
    12. Workflows:

      • Manage and update workflow steps.

    These functions enable developers to create rich integrations with Slack, automate tasks, and enhance communication within teams. For detailed information on each endpoint, you can refer to the Slack API documentation.

    What information do I need to provide to list files from Google Drive using its API?

    To list files from Google Drive using its API, you need to provide certain information and follow specific steps. Here's a breakdown of what you need:

    1. Google Cloud Project Setup:

      • Create a Google Cloud Project: You need to have a Google Cloud project with the Google Drive API enabled.
      • OAuth 2.0 Credentials: Set up OAuth 2.0 credentials to authenticate your application. This typically involves creating a client ID and client secret.
    2. Authentication:

      • Access Token: Obtain an access token using OAuth 2.0. This token is required to authorize API requests on behalf of a user.
    3. API Request:

      • HTTP Method: Use the GET method to request the list of files.
      • Endpoint: The endpoint to list files is https://www.googleapis.com/drive/v3/files.
      • Query Parameters: You can include various query parameters to filter and customize the file listing:
        • q: A query string for filtering files (e.g., q='mimeType='application/vnd.google-apps.folder' to list folders).
        • fields: Specify which fields to include in the response (e.g., fields=files(id, name)).
        • pageSize: The maximum number of files to return per page.
        • pageToken: Token for continuing a previous list request on the next page.
    4. Scopes:

      • Drive Scopes: Specify the appropriate OAuth scopes. For listing files, you might use https://www.googleapis.com/auth/drive.readonly for read-only access.
    5. Handling the Response:

      • JSON Response: The API will return a JSON response containing the list of files and their metadata based on the specified fields.
    6. Error Handling:

      • Implement error handling to manage issues such as authentication errors, rate limits, and API quota limits.

    By providing the above information and following these steps, you can successfully list files from Google Drive using its API.
